Key Insights into the Pharmaceutical Water Market
The global pharmaceutical water market is experiencing significant growth, driven by several factors. Recent studies indicate that the demand for pharmaceutical-grade water is anticipated to reach USD 89.9 billion by 2034, growing at a healthy compound annual growth rate (CAGR) of 9.3%. This increase reflects a concerted effort within the industry, especially as healthcare demands heighten worldwide.
Market Growth Factors
Rise in Mergers and Acquisitions
Companies within the pharmaceutical sector are adopting strategic initiatives like mergers and acquisitions to enhance their market presence. For instance, Evoqua Water Technologies has made significant strides by acquiring renal business assets from prominent firms, which boosts their service offerings in the healthcare vertical.
Emerging Market Demand
Countries like Brazil, India, and China are witnessing a surge in pharmaceutical production owing to the growth of generic drug manufacturing and biotechnology sectors. The increased investment in R&D within these regions is leading to heightened demand for pharmaceutical water treatment systems, which are vital for ensuring product quality.
Biologic Drug Development Trends
Biopharmaceuticals are on the rise and necessitate extensive use of purified water in drug production. As the industry shifts towards single-use technologies in bioprocessing, there's a growing requirement for compatible water systems that adhere to stringent regulatory standards for drug manufacturing.
Regulatory Standards and Market Drivers
Manufacturers are compelled to utilize high-quality water to meet the rigorous standards set by regulatory agencies such as the FDA. This includes a strict focus on water purity, particularly for applications like water for injection (WFI) and purified water (PW). The surge in chronic diseases and an aging population are also significant drivers contributing to the overall growth of the pharmaceutical water market.
Market Constraints
Despite the promising growth trajectory, the pharmaceutical water market faces hurdles. The high costs associated with advanced purification technologies such as reverse osmosis and distillation can be a barrier for smaller manufacturers. In addition, energy consumption and water scarcity in some areas lead to further operational challenges, complicating consistent supply chain management.
Innovations and Sustainability Opportunities
Technological advancements are paving the way for cost-effective and energy-efficient water treatment solutions. The growing focus on sustainability also opens opportunities for recycling and reusing water in manufacturing processes, which not only minimizes waste but also meets environmental standards.
